Type
ORACLE
Validation date
2024-02-18 11:49: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03478,
    "usd": 0.03748
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00019EE3D6E73E0F250A0652F4AD5D28F33E90EBCEE5376BAEE5F19564B9ED83A465

Previous signature

86B504AEBA5185BA2D563A5627B87176709D3155B040C156F96517CE30782FEF12251F6EAC5F820E5EE7F0BC6DCD31B3223CAC02D072831BC66B81218F876D03

Origin signature

3044022010A62924077DEC7C4BBEB75DD23F6EB0F8B215821F37E2A262A05C79AE37848102205B674CE2CE40B0845E1532BD8F6E9DD95B7170F60872754DD224871C79EE7481

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

0049F1329D40B0F29392F9B2BCE5D913BCD5F0541BC961D0E7E7B738043D43D495

Coordinator signature

BBF182709850BF90890E27C0DD60A7EE4D80C3B91535516BBB42EF1FE89D7A2A522A7DFF5D8303A17D3D1AA0F47C8F4BEEC9CD71A33A1CD92E589BDE1737560F

Validator #1 public key

000103E30584AD8DE66F9E29419D5D0ABEE5A76722C9FD0D012BDDE3A6E2B149C48D

Validator #1 signature

97A08C65331886D89917C6C6C4B35B893279E89F2D5A6DED57859218BD5410DBA42B612866EB8600CFA14D88593A70D2FEEDF4814524322DCEA6986F6E176205

Validator #2 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#2 signature

56956100A89539DD08E57A4B38B9E580A7D9630A075D2AD88EB1715EDA4CD8B24F4D769FB4B02AC3C93438CBC8BA30ADCDD6C1ECC7EA852CA29E1ECCD8E7B506